Art workshop to be held at Penney High School Aug. 9-13

Enlighten your mind and inspire others by participating in a summer art workshop, featuring Shannon Christensen, local artist and member of the Portrait Society of America. The workshop will be held at Penney High School in Hamilton during the week of Aug. 9-13. Registration for the workshop is now open online at www.confidencetolearn.com or by calling 660-749-5389.

The workshop features three classes, according to age group, and an art show on Friday at 6 p.m. for students to share their art work.

In the first class, Copy Cat Kids, children between the ages of nine and 12 cultivate their drawing skills as they imitate the works of past and present masters and learn line and value. There is a charge for the classes (which includes the cost of materials) per child and will be Monday, Tuesday, and Thursday from 12:30 to 1:15 p.m.

The second class, Body Basics, for ages 13 to 17, helps students develop their sketching skills as they learn the basics of drawing the human figure. Classes will be Monday, Tuesday and Thursday from 1:30 to 2:15 p.m. There is a charge for the instruction and materials.

In Black and White Basics (ages 18 and up), adults immerse themselves in the wide world of black and white as Shannon Christensen helps them explore artistic value with oil paints. The class includes a masterful demonstration and then leaves the students at liberty to paint any still life they desire. Some drawing and oil painting experience is suggested. Classes will be Monday, Tuesday, and Thursday from 2:30 to 4:30. There is a charge for the classes, which includes instruction and materials.

The workshop is sponsored by Confidence to Learn, a local non-profit organization, and other local businesses.
